I have a 2001 Accord EX DOHC VTEC
When the car is off, I hear a buzzing coming from the rear drivers side.

Like I will come home and be out side 2 hours later and hear a faint buzz that lasts about 5-10 seconds, then it goes away. Only happens when the car isnt running and no keys are in or anything. I was going to take it to the dealer, but they want 80 bucks just to look at it. It has been happening for about a year now, no problems with the car...its strange, like it comes from around the trunk, rear wheel area.
Anyone heard of this, or encountered it before?

lol, no man, your cars not DOHC. its SOHC. h22 and h23's are motors that are DOHC and are swappable into our cars. your car is probably 100% stock, so its either got the variation of the f23 (sohc 4 cylinder) or j30 (sohc v6)

fuel pump problem? it sounds like a little buzzing sound when you put in ur key. Maybe there is a short somewhere. Try disconnecting your battery and listen for the sound. If u still hear it, then U know its not an electrical problem.
